  "bluf": "Mandated by U.S. Executive Order 14028, this standard from the NTIA defines the minimum required data fields, formats, and practices for a Software Bill of Materials (SBOM). It requires all software producers to provide SBOMs that list components, versions, suppliers, and dependency relationships to enhance software supply chain transparency for consumers and operators.",
